Is the use of Gynaset CR Tablet safe for pregnant women?
Gynaset CR Tablet should not be taken during pregnancy, or should only be taken on the advice of a doctor as it may have severe side effects.
Is the use of Gynaset CR Tablet safe during breastfeeding?
Women who are breastfeeding may experience severe harmful effects after taking Gynaset CR Tablet. It should only be taken after medical advice.

Yes, Gynaset CR Tablet prevents or suppresses ovulation in females taking it. However, it is recommended to consult your doctor before taking this medicine for preventing ovulation.
Gynaset CR Tablet should be taken as recommended by your doctor. Inform your doctor if you are feeling nausea and dizziness after taking this drug. You will get your periods within 2-3 days after stopping this medicine. By any chance, if you do not get your periods till 7 days after discontinuing this medicine talk to your doctor immediately and take a test for pregnancy.
Yes, Gynaset CR Tablet can cause weight gain. It is a common side effect of it. However, if you feel excess gain of weight after taking this medicine, please inform your doctor.
